For Mercedes Benz, one of the most anticipated appearances at the show will be the new C-Klasse coupe, whose details and a more extensive gallery were released over the weekend. Powered by a choice of only two new engines, a 201 hp four cylinder (C250) and a 302 hp V6 (C350), the new coupe plans to preview the next generation C-Klasse sedan, which will be released later this year. Packed with technology (starting from the wide array of telematics systems and ending with the not less so array of safety features), the new two-door C-Klasse plans to tap into a market segment until recently occupied by the CLK: that of youthful, stylish and expressive people (read a target group which usually goes for the coupe versions of the BMW 3 Series and the Audi A5).. "By extending the C-Class portfolio, we are consciously targeting new customers," said Joachim Schmidt, head of Sales and Marketing at Mercedes-Benz Cars.
